Perylene-based dyes with methoxy groups at various positions were synthesized to understand the effect of the methoxy groups on the fluorescence quenching. Additionally, perylene-based dyes with ethyl groups in place of the methoxy groups were also synthesized to serve as control. Absorption and fluorescence properties of the dyes were measured, and then, density functional theory (DFT) and time-dependent density functional theory (TD-DFT) simulations were conducted. The methoxy groups of terminal-substituents had a lesser effect on fluorescence quenching than the methoxy groups of bay-substituents. Moreover, only the methoxy groups at the para-position of the bay-substituents strongly affected on fluorescence quenching. These results showed that the fluorescence of the dyes are influenced by the electron donating effect of the methoxy groups when the methoxy groups are involved in the main conjugation systems of the dyes.
